Aloha...we would like to invite you to come & stay at our 'Hale Kaupe' which means in Hawaiian humble home & experience Island living! Our cottage is located downstairs.

We are fortunate to live in one of the most amazing spots on the North Shore of Oahu. We are directly across the street from the beautiful Ali'i Beach, Park & Harbor. Walking distance to Historic Haleiwa Town, a quaint shopping village with fine markets, fine restaurants and unrivaled outdoor activities. We are 10 min. from Waimea Bay & Valley, 20 min. from Pipeline, Ehukai & Sunset Beach! Not to mention 45 minutes from the airport & down town Honolulu. The best of both worlds!

                This was my first visit to Hawaii and I wanted a non-resort, small town experience with lots of local flavor. Hale Kaupe is the perfect spot! Haleiwa is a small surfing town on the North Shore with lots of shopping and really good food. I was able to walk or ride a bike everywhere around town and only used my car for trips to the airport or to explore the island. There is also a bus that runs through town if you want to explore further as well. Hale Kaupe is just steps away from the beach and a beautiful park to watch the surfers or sunsets.
